The new primary mathematics curriculum lists ‘encouraging playfulness’ as a key pedagogical practice. While playful approaches based on the Aistear framework are common in junior primary, many teachers are unsure about how playfulness might be encouraged in senior primary.

In this webinar, Blair Minchin, a primary teacher based in Scotland, will share his approach to playful mathematics learning in senior primary.

Blair Michin is a primary teacher based in Scotland. He is very active on social media, sharing his classroom practice and encouraging other teachers to try new ideas. In addition to a focus on playfulness in upper primary, Blair has shared his practice involving teaching music, the effective use of digital technologies, and teaching using the Sustainable Development Goals.
